<p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r">Arabia Weather - The latest forecasts, according to the National Center of Meteorology, indicate that the weather tomorrow, Tuesday, will be fair to partly cloudy at times, with a chance of some cumulus clouds accompanied by rain falling in some eastern and western regions.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> The expected winds are southeasterly to northeasterly, light to moderate speed, active at times, stirring dust, with speeds ranging from 10 to 20, reaching 35 km/hour, and the sea will be light in waves in the Arabian Gulf and in the Sea of Oman.</p>
